| dc.description.abstract | Abstract Barnacles are sessile marine crustaceans with significant ecological and economic impacts, particularly due to their widespread distribution and strong substrate adhesion. Understanding their reproductive physiology is crucial for managing their effects on marine industries and aquaculture. This review examines optimized protocols for tissue sample processing in barnacle reproductive studies, focusing on species native to Korean coastal waters such as Amphibalanus eburneus and Balanus trigonus. Key steps, including sample collection, decalcification, fixation, tissue dissection, processing, embedding, sectioning, staining, and mounting, are detailed, with an emphasis on minimizing tissue damage and maximizing histological clarity. Comparative analysis of decalcification agents, such as commercial Decalcifier and acetic acid–ethanol mixtures, reveals differences in tissue preservation and processing efficiency. The review also discusses challenges unique to barnacle histology, including the removal of calcareous exoskeleton and the preparation of high-quality sections for microscopic evaluation of reproductive structures. The summarized protocols and recommendations aim to enhance reproducibility and reliability in barnacle reproductive biology research, providing a foundation for further studies on their biology and management in marine environments. | - |
